    Cable trays need to have their support structures calculated

    The cable tray support span must be determined based on the manufacturer's load capacity chart and the total anticipated weight of the cables. Cable tray support quantity can be calculated using a simple formula: Support Quantity = Total Length ÷ Support Spacing + 1 20 ÷ 2 + 1 = 11 supports In a typical project, a 20-meter cable tray with 2-meter spacing requires 11 supports.     Does optical fiber play a significant role in overhead power lines

    The integration of fiber optics into overhead power lines has revolutionized how power grids operate, enabling greater efficiency, enhanced reliability, and improved safety. For monitoring and managing networks, they use a variety of means of communications, including running fiber optic cables along the transmission and distribution towers, radio links and contracting landline and cellular communications services from telecom carriers. Utilities build fiber optic. Optical attached cable (OPAC) is a type of fibre-optic cable that is installed by being attached to a host conductor along overhead power lines. Utilities saw that, too, but to them, sending signals over glass solved a major problem: electrical interference from high-voltage transmission lines.
